World
North America
USA
Illinois
Chicago
Restaurants
Super Burrito
6322 W Grand Ave
Chicago, Illinois 60639
USA
Phone: 773-622-3160
Super Gyros
2524 S California Ave
Chicago, Illinois 60608
USA
Phone: 312-696-4000
Super Submarine
3943 W Roosevelt Rd
Chicago, Illinois 60624
USA
Phone: 773-522-2629
Surf City Squeeze
444 W Jackson Blvd # 3
Chicago, Illinois 60606
USA
Phone: 312-441-0287
Sushi 28 Cafe
2863 N Clark St
Chicago, Illinois 60657
USA
Phone: 773-868-1250
Sushi Luxe
5204 N Clark St
Chicago, Illinois 60640
USA
Phone: 773-334-0770
Sushi Mura
3647 N Southport Ave
Chicago, Illinois 60613
USA
Phone: 773-281-9155
Sushi O Sushi
346 W Armitage Ave
Chicago, Illinois 60614
USA
Phone: 773-871-4777
Sushi Para II
2256 N Clark St
Chicago, Illinois 60614
USA
Phone: 773-477-3219
Sushi Pink
909 W Washington Blvd
Chicago, Illinois 60607
USA
Phone: 312-226-1666
Sushi Sai
123 N Wacker Dr
Chicago, Illinois 60606
USA
Phone: 312-332-8822
Sushi Samba Rio
504 N Wells St
Chicago, Illinois 60654
USA
Phone: 312-329-0268